
BMW 1 Series118i [1.5] Sport 5dr [Nav]
2016
54,767 miles
Petrol
£9,583
22 miles away
£9,583
£8,990
£33,990
£25,989
£34,374
£872 off£31,190
£688 off£29,990
£688 off£32,490
£1,188 off£30,989
£35,190
£1,288 off£24,989
£31,906
£28,276
£774 off£30,820
£1,918 off£23,261
£459 off£30,790
£29,404
£902 off£21,056
£754 off19-36 of 52 vehicles